Drawn with the sketchbook inverted, the subject continues, with St Paul’s Cathedral and Somerset House, on folio 85 (D07100; Turner Bequest CV 75). The significance of the numbers, written by what look like steps at the top of the leaf, is unclear. See Introduction for plans in the mid 1820s for a series of London subjects, including London Bridge, the Custom House and the Tower. For Waterloo Bridge, see note to folio 81 (D07092; Turner Bequest CV 71).
